Curve (CRV): The "Curve War" Engine

Tokenomics Breakdown

  1. Lock CRV for veCRV: Longer locks = more voting power.
  2. Weekly Gauge Votes: Top pools get 2.5× CRV rewards.
  3. Ecosystem Flywheel: Projects bribe voters to boost their pools’ rewards.

Critical Metrics

📉 CRV Price Stability: Collapse risks ecosystem collapse.
📊 TVL Trends: Reflects confidence in the bribe economy.

FAQs

Q: Which DEX token has the strongest governance?
A: UNI—its proposals directly control treasury funds.

Q: What drives CRV’s value?
A: Voting power demand from protocols in "Curve Wars."

Q: Is CAKE deflationary now?
A: Yes, but adoption of burn mechanisms remains key.


Conclusion

Each DEX token serves unique purposes—governance (UNI), bribe markets (CRV), or utility (CAKE). Avoid cross-comparisons; instead, assess their models within respective ecosystems.
